What is a Tier 3 data center? A tier 3 data center is a concurrently maintainable facility with multiple distribution paths for power and cooling. Unlike tier 1 and 2 data centers, a tier 3 facility does not require a total shutdown during maintenance or equipment replacement.

What are the 3 main components of a data center infrastructure? 

The primary elements of a data center break down as follows:
  • Facility – the usable space available for IT equipment.
  • Core components – equipment and software for IT operations and storage of data and applications.
  • Support infrastructure – equipment contributing to securely sustaining the highest availability possible.

Is data center a cloud?

The main difference between the public cloud and a data center is where the data is stored. In a data center, data is most often stored on the premises of your organization. Some data centers may be in locations not owned by your organization—in this case, your data center is colocated, but not in the cloud.

What is the difference between a datacenter and cloud computing?

The main difference between the cloud vs. data center is that a data center refers to on-premise hardware while the cloud refers to off-premise computing. The cloud stores your data in the public cloud, while a data center stores your data on your own hardware.

Which is more secure cloud or data center?

While your data in the cloud may be more secure than in your data center, a move to the cloud does bring some new security concerns. The single biggest concern is the security of the communications link between your data center and the cloud data center where your data and applications are stored.

Where is AWS data center?

In the US, the company operates in some 38 facilities in Northern Virginia, eight in San Francisco, another eight in its hometown of Seattle and seven in northeastern Oregon. In Europe, it has seven data center buildings in Dublin, Ireland, four in Germany, and three in Luxembourg.

Where are Google’s data centers?

The largest known centers are located in The Dalles, Oregon; Atlanta, Georgia; Reston, Virginia; Lenoir, North Carolina; and Moncks Corner, South Carolina. In Europe, the largest known centers are in Eemshaven and Groningen in the Netherlands and Mons, Belgium.

Do data centers recycle water?

Data centres consume water directly for cooling, in some cases 57% sourced from potable water, and indirectly through the water requirements of non-renewable electricity generation.
